Using a SAS Macro Catalog

To use any of the macros contained in an Oracle Life Sciences Data Hub SAS Macro Catalog, you create a Source Code instance in the Program from which you need to call them.

Do the following:

  1. In the Oracle LSH SAS Program where you need to use one or more of the macros in the Catalog, create a Source Code as an instance of an existing definition.
  2. In the Search screen, choose the Domain or Domain and Application Area where the Macro Catalog you need is located, and select the SAS Macro Catalog radio button. If you know the exact name of the Macro Catalog you need, enter it in the Name field.
  3. Click Go. The system returns the Macro Catalog(s) that satisfy the search criteria—or, if you entered the exact name of a Macro Catalog, returns only that one.
  4. Select a Macro Catalog: select its box in the Select column and click the Select button. The system adds an instance of the Catalog, including all the macros it contains, and returns you to the Source Code screen.

You can now use any of the macros in your Program. At execution they are added to your work library and you can call them by name from the primary source code.
